The progress of license plates sent by the DMV can be checked through the following methods: calling 11183, using the Traffic Management 12123 app, or the Postal APP. Generally, it takes 3-4 days for the license plate to be delivered. The license plate delivery service is provided by EMS, and the delivery speed might be slightly slower. Typically, from the time the license plate is sent out to the owner receiving it, it should not exceed one week at the latest. Below are the detailed methods: 11183 Phone Inquiry: 11183 is the phone number for China Post EMS. After dialing, transfer to the customer service representative, provide the license plate number, and you can inquire about the logistics progress. Traffic Management 12123 App Inquiry: Register and log in to the app. For Apple devices with iOS 15 or above, use the Traffic Management 12123 app (V2.8.1B437). You can check the progress of the license plate under the "Online Progress" section. Once the license plate is made and shipped, you can also track the logistics. If your phone number is bound, you will receive an SMS notification when the license plate is shipped. Postal APP Inquiry: For Apple devices with iOS 15 or above, download the Postal APP (V3.5.5). This is the official APP of China Post. Open the APP, and at the top, there is a search bar for mail progress. Click to enter the inquiry page. On the page, select "Motor Vehicle License Plate," enter the license plate number or acceptance number, and you can check the progress. The Traffic Management 12123 app is the official client of the Internet Traffic Safety Comprehensive Service Management Platform, supported by the Traffic Management Research Institute of the Ministry of Public Security. It provides comprehensive traffic safety services for vehicle owners and drivers, including user registration, vehicle and driver's license services, appointment and processing of violations, traffic safety information inquiries, business reminders, navigation to traffic management service locations, and new online self-service traffic violation handling. Main Features: User registration; Binding personal vehicles and driver's licenses; Handling violations recorded by electronic monitoring devices; Driver's license exam appointments; Pre-selection of new vehicle license plates; Replacement of vehicle registration certificates, license plates, and driver's licenses; Replacement of vehicle safety inspection certificates; Extension of driver's license renewal, review, and submission of physical condition certificates; Inquiries and notifications related to vehicles and driver's licenses; Navigation to traffic management service locations; New online self-service traffic violation handling.
